@charset "UTF-8";
/* CSS Document */

* {
		margin:0;
		padding:0;
		}

	html, body {
		height:100%;
		}
	body {
		font-family: Verdana, Geneva, sans-serif;
		background-color:#000;
		color:#000;
	}
		
	h1 {
		font-size:16px;
		color:#000;
		font-weight:bold;
	}
	
	p {
		font-size:10px;
	}
	
	a:link {
		text-decoration:none;
		color:#d90b09;
		font-weight:bold;
	}
	
	a:visited {
		text-decoration:none;
		color:#d90b09;
		font-weight:bold;
	}
	
	a:hover, active {
		color:#000000;
	}

	#distance {
		width:1px;
		height:50%;
		margin-bottom:-257px; /* halbe höhe des aussen-containers */
		float:left;
		}

	#container {
		margin:0 auto;
		position:relative;
		text-align:left;
		height:514px;
		width:773px;
		clear:left;
		background-color:#FFF;
		}
	
	#logo {
	position:absolute;
	top:0px;
	left:559px;
	width:215px;
	height:150px;
	z-index:2;
	}

	#navi {
	position:absolute;
	top:35px;
	left:30px;
	width:100px;
	height:auto;
	}
	
	#content {
	position:absolute;
	width:400px;
	height: 427px;
	top:38px;
	left:150px;
	overflow: auto;
	color:#ffffff;
	font-weight:bold;
	padding-bottom:30px;
	}
	
	.songs {color:#000;}
	
	/* NEWS */
	
	#news {
	position:absolute;
	top: 97px;
	left:143px;
	}
	
	#newslogos {
	position:absolute;
	top:394px;
	left:143px;
	width:524px;
	height:auto;
	}
	
	#newslogostext {
	position:absolute;
	top: 404px;
	left: 676px;
	width:40px;
	height:58px;
	text-align:center;
	}
	
	#counter {
	position:absolute;
	top:415px;
	left:0px;
	height:auto;
	width:100px;
	/*background-color:#ffffff;*/
	text-align:center;
	/*padding-top:10px;
	padding-bottom:5px;*/
	}
	
	/* PARTNERLINKS */
	
	div.partnerlinks {
		float:left;
		width:375px;
		height:auto;
		text-align:left;
		padding-top:20px;
	}
	
	div.bilder {
		float: left;
		width: 180px;
		height: auto;
	}
	
	div.linktext {
		float:left;
		width:160px;
		text-align:left;
		vertical-align:middle;
		padding-top:20px;
		padding-left:20px;
	}
		
		
		
	/* IM HANDEL */
	#handel {
	position:absolute;
	top:0px;
	left:574px;
	width:167px;
	height: 447px;
	z-index:1
	}
	
		
	/* INFO */
	#info {
	position:absolute;
	top:122px;
	left:200px;
	width:342px;
	height: 355px;
	text-align:right;
	font-weight:bold;
	color:#000000;
	}
	
	/* BIO */

	#bio {
	position:absolute;
	width:400px;
	height: 445px;
	top:38px;
	left:150px;
	overflow: auto;
	color:#000000;
	font-size:10px;
	padding-right:5px;
	}
	
	div.bioframe {
	visibility:visible;	
	}
	
	div.biopic {
		float:left;
		width:auto;
		height:auto;
		padding-bottom: 5px;
		padding-right: 8px;
	}
	
	div.biopic img{
		border:0px;
		}
	
	div.biopic2 {
		float:right;
		width:auto;
		height:auto;
		padding-left: 8px;
		padding-bottom: 5px;
		}
		
	#popup1 {
		position:absolute;
		top:80px;
		left:180px;
		text-align:center;
		visibility:hidden
	}
	#popup2 {
		position:absolute;
		top:50px;
		left:180px;
		text-align:center;
		visibility:hidden
	}
	#popup3 {
		position:absolute;
		top:80px;
		left:180px;
		text-align:center;
		visibility:hidden
	}
	#popup4 {
		position:absolute;
		top:80px;
		left:180px;
		text-align:center;
		visibility:hidden
	}
	#popup5 {
		position:absolute;
		top:50px;
		left:180px;
		text-align:center;
		visibility:hidden
	}
	#popup6 {
		position:absolute;
		top:50px;
		left:180px;
		text-align:center;
		visibility:hidden
	}
		
	
	/* MUSIK */
	
	#musik {
	position:absolute;
	width:400px;
	height: 300px;
	top:99px;
	left:169px;
	overflow: auto;
	color:#ffffff;
	font-weight:bold;
	}
	
	#musik p {
		color:#000000;
		}
	/* ACCORDEON MENU */
	
	.menu_list {	
	width: 100px;
	}
	
	.menu_head {
		font-size:16px;
		color:#000;
		font-weight:bold;
		position: relative;
		text-align:center;
   		background: #ffffff;
		padding-bottom:5px;
		padding-top:5px;
	}

	.menu_body {
	display:none;
	}

	.menu_body a{
  	display:block;
  	color:#000000;
  	padding-left:10px;
	text-align:center;
  	text-decoration:none;
	padding-top:5px;
	font-weight:normal;
	}

	.menu_body a:hover{
  	color: #d90b09;
  	text-decoration:none;
  	}

